Yule, the Pagan Celebration of the Winter Solstice, is an ancient tradition with its roots in the Germanic and Nordic traditions. The Pagan calendar is a wheel, and, like all Pagan holidays, Yule begins a new chapter, a new cycle. There are myriad beginnings and endings in the wheel of the year, and each of them lead into something new, before it eventually feeds back into itself, reminding us that there are new lessons to be learned in old places.

Yule is tied to the seasons, to the harvest, to the sun, the moon, and the stars. It is the darkest day of the year, but it actually kicks off our return to light. Every day throughout winter, we will get a bit more warmth, and a bit more light. Therefore, even though winter is our darkest season, where food is scarce and the weather harshest, it is cosmically and spiritually working to return us to the light. Much like the New Moon brings about a period of growth and abundance, so does winter.

Yule also encapsulates the spirit of winter, family, and giving. Historically, when times were tough, food was scarce, and travel impossible through ice and snow, we have leaned on those closest to us. Yule is about togetherness, about staying safe inside, about both conservation and giving, about sharing.

Monday, December 21

“Yule—Yul log for the Christmas-fire tale-spinner—of fairy tales that can come true: Yul Brynner.Marianne Moore

It’s officially Yule! The darkest and shortest day of the year. From today until the first of January, people across the world will be celebrating Yule, the solstice, and other holidays. Today is a great day for baking something sweet, using canned jams and goods, and of course, building a fire. The Yule Log burns in your hearth or in spirit. When the tradition first began, an entire tree would be cut down and burned in the hearth, starting with the bottom. It would be allowed to burn for all twelve days of Yule, uninterrupted. Modern fire codes make this pretty impossible, but many people still burn a Yule Log, placing one large log into the fire and letting it burn itself all the way out as a form of welcoming the return of light and luck in the new year.
